skipnchar wrote:
Dot safety plate is prescribed by federal law and standard engineering mathematics are used in computing capacities. There is a LOT more to it than axle size. In determining GVWR numbers they take into account brake system, cooling system and the entire drive line from tranny through axles. it is all a standard formula where the weakest link determines the rating.
This, specifically stopping distances and vehicle handling. There are many factors other than the sum of all components.
